The Airbus A380 is the largest commercial passenger aircraft in the world, with a capacity of up to 853 passengers. Its massive size has made it an iconic airplane that has drawn attention and awe from aviation enthusiasts and travelers alike.  The aircraft just recently made it ,safe landing in Bali’s Ngurah Rai, the International Airport welcomed the Emirates’A380 for the first time.

Bali’s capability to accept and welcome A380 in Bali had several impacts on the island’s aviation industry. First, it attracted a significant amount of attention from aviation enthusiasts and travelers alike, increasing the airport’s visibility and prestige. Additionally, the A380’s size required significant modifications to the airport’s infrastructure, including the widening of taxiways and the installation of larger parking areas. These modifications required significant investment from the airport’s operators and the local government. Finally, the increased passenger capacity provided by the A380 has allowed airlines to increase the number of tourists visiting Bali, providing a significant boost to the island’s tourism industry.

The Airbus A380 is a massive aircraft, measuring 72.7 meters in length, 24.1 meters in height, and 79.8 meters in wingspan. The aircraft has a maximum takeoff weight of 590 tons, making it one of the heaviest airplanes in the world. The sheer size of the A380 presents numerous challenges for airports, including the need for specialized infrastructure such as larger runways, taxiways, and parking areas.

The A380 is designed to carry a large number of passengers, with a maximum capacity of up to 853 people. This is achieved through a two-deck cabin layout, which allows for more cabin space and a higher density of seats. The first deck typically houses the first-class and business-class cabins, while the second deck is reserved for economy-class passengers. The A380’s ability to carry a large number of passengers has made it a popular choice for airlines operating in high-traffic routes, such as those connecting major cities.

The A380’s cabin is divided into several zones, each with its own unique features and amenities. The first-class cabin typically features individual suites with sliding doors, fully flat beds, and personal entertainment screens. Business-class cabins often have lie-flat seats and larger personal screens. Economy-class cabins are designed for comfort and space efficiency, with advanced seat designs that allow for increased legroom and recline angles. Additionally, the A380’s cabin is equipped with the latest in-flight entertainment systems, including touch-screen displays and high-speed internet connectivity.
